In describing the timing of Drosophila development, researchers use AEL to mean "After egg laying", for example, 40 h AEL means

40 hours after egg laying. At 25o C, a fruit fly of 75 h AEL is at:A. Embryonic stageB. Larval stageC. Pupal stage

Answer:

A fruit fly of 75h AEL is at larval stage.

Explanation:

The development of a Drosophilia starts from egg to larva to pupa then to adult. The full development at 25 degrees Celsius takes between 8.5 to 10 days. The higher the temperature, the faster the development of the Drosophilia.

The eggs hatch after 12-15 hours into larval stage which then lasts for 3-4 days(72-96 hours) then the pupal stage which also lasts for 3-4 days before it becomes a full adult.

Thus, 72 hours after egg laying would still be in larval stage. The larval stage ends after at leas 90 hours after egg laying.
